2012-06-26 3 views
2

Я в настоящее время JSP с выбором, который выглядит следующим образом:Передать все параметры из списка выбора в другой JSP

<select name="withoutAccess" size="5"> 

<c:foreach var="item" items="${obj.withoutAccess}"> 
    <option>${item}</option> 
    </c:foreach> 
</select> 

Ради ясности, я только вывешиваю список выбора, как отдых работает хорошо.

Теперь, в моей форме, когда я нажимаю кнопку отправки, я хочу поймать все значения в списке выбора на другой странице.

Мне только удается получить опцию, выбранную в этом списке, когда я нажимаю кнопку.

Как я могу получить остальное?

Я пробовал с request.getParameterValues ​​("withoutAccess"), но у него есть только один вариант, тот, который выбран.

ответ

0

Ну, я нашел одно решение.

Создать яваскрипт скрипт, который помещает все параметры с выбранным = верно, что, как я могу поймать их в запросе :)

1

Только выбранные параметры когда-либо отправляются в сообщении формы. Если вы хотите получить весь список параметров, вам нужно снова просмотреть их (то есть из базы данных) или сохранить их в постоянном хранилище, таком как состояние сеанса или приложения.

+0

Но как я могу сохранить сохранения изменений? – Wasted

Смежные вопросы